About Me
I'm a stay-at-home mom of one with one on the way...both boys! I am pursuing a four-year degree in civil engineering technology. My first two years of college I played soccer. I never thought I would stop playing the game but felt deeply that there was something more out there for me. I was raised in the church and knew the standards well. However, soccer games were sometimes scheduled for Sunday. Because of practice schedules, I could not always make it to other church activities. I was very reserved and shy so missing other activities at first did not bother me. I guess that I was in a big slump, depressed, and trying to find myself. It affected my game and confidence poorly. I began to embrace the church activities showing up late after practice. I eventually started reading the scriptures again daily, praying, asking the Lord for answers. I wanted to be happy. I eventually dropped soccer so that I was guarenteed to attend church every Sunday. I was happier. I made friends. I was more outgoing. I was confident. I found who I was by knowing my Heavenly Father more intimately. When family turned their backs on me, I remembered that I had my Heavenly Father who loved me. This helped me succeed in life with everything I did...school, family, work, etc. I obtained a Bachelors in Information Technology and later married my eternal companion. It's not easy being a mother but I love my boys and my faith keeps me going. I'm playing soccer again...we are one happy eternal league.
Why I am a Mormon
I chose to be a mormon because it makes me happy. There isn't one big event that made me this way. I just know that the gospel of Jesus Christ is true. I know that I have a loving Father in heaven who knows what I need and when I need it. He is always willing to help and guide me. As I have taken time to know Him better and live a righteous life, I am happier.

How I live my faith
At times I can be very assertive and at others more withdrawn. I suppose that I am more subtle about how I live my faith. I live it by example. Not everyone is aware that I am a Mormon but they will see that I care. I develop friendships, I participare in a Mom's Club, I get to know my neighbors, and in general try to help those in need. I vote. I lead. I try to do things that will make a difference. I am not perfect but I strive for it. I try everyday to be a better person.
